Solution for 12x-(8x-3)=7 equation:



12x-(8x-3)=7
We move all terms to the left:
12x-(8x-3)-(7)=0
We get rid of parentheses
12x-8x+3-7=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
4x-4=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
4x=4
x=4/4
x=1
